Taco Biscuit Appetizers
These Taco Biscuit Appetizers are flavorful, cheesy bites combining seasoned ground beef, melted cheddar, and flaky crescent rolls. Perfect for parties or quick snacks, they offer a savory combination of spices and cheesy goodness wrapped in buttery pastry, appealing to both kids and adults alike.
Ingredients
Instructions
- Brown the ground beef and chopped onion in a skillet.
- Drain off excess fat from the meat mixture.
- Add taco seasoning and 3/4 cup water to the meat and onion.
- Cook for 15 minutes until thickened.
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Spread each can of crescent rolls into two oblongs on a cookie sheet.
- Spread a thin line of meat mixture down each crescent roll.
- Top with shredded cheddar cheese.
- Fold over the dough and pinch to seal.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 10 to 12 minutes until golden brown.
- Cut into bite-sized pieces and serve warm.
